The Built-In Bypass Soft Starter is an essential solution for controlling large motors in modern electrical systems. By combining gradual voltage application with an integrated bypass mechanism, it provides smooth motor acceleration and stable long-term performance. This design reduces wear on both electrical and mechanical components, ensuring motors run efficiently throughout their service life.

One of the central benefits of using this device is the reduction of electrical disturbances. Traditional motor starting methods often cause sudden current surges that can disrupt nearby equipment. A soft starter mitigates this by gradually ramping up the voltage. Once the motor reaches its full operating speed, the built-in bypass ensures that energy is transferred efficiently, without unnecessary losses.

In addition to protecting the electrical network, this approach also safeguards mechanical systems. For instance, in conveyors or fans, controlled acceleration prevents sudden strain on moving parts. In pumps, it reduces water hammer and protects seals and valves. These benefits contribute to reduced maintenance needs and longer equipment lifespan.

The integrated bypass design also supports cost-effectiveness. By removing the need for an external bypass contactor, installation becomes more straightforward, requiring fewer components and less space within the electrical cabinet. Maintenance tasks are similarly simplified, which helps reduce downtime and service costs.

Compatibility with various motor types is another practical feature. Many built-in bypass soft starters are designed according to international standards, making them suitable for diverse applications in manufacturing, energy, and infrastructure projects. Their adaptability ensures they can be used across multiple industries with minimal adjustments.

The technology also supports improved workplace safety. By preventing sudden starts and maintaining consistent voltage control, it reduces risks of equipment failure and electrical faults. This creates a safer operating environment for both equipment and personnel.

Whether in small facilities or large-scale industrial plants, the built-in bypass soft starter offers a reliable way to achieve efficient motor control. Its combination of smooth operation, energy savings, and ease of use makes it a practical addition to modern electrical systems.
